Police Integrity Commission (PIC), the state’s independent police oversight body has stated that the Commissioner of Police Abdulla Riyaz was appointed according to the law.
The legality of the appointment of Abdulla Riyaz was hotly debated following the controversial change of power in February 2012. PIC said that the matter was not officially filed with the Commission, but said that they have collected documents to determine if the matter should be officially investigated.
Police Integrity Commission stated that their review of the documents prove that the Commissioner of Police, Abdulla Riyaz was appointed according to the law, under Article 52 (a) and Article 52 (b) of the Police Act.
Article 52 (a) of the Police Act states that a person must be appointed to the rank of Commissioner of Police, within the high-ranking police officers, as the senior most officer responsible for the organization and management of regular affairs of the police in discharging its roles and functions.
Article 52 (b) states that the President shall appoint and dismiss the Commissioner of Police.
